Illegal Immigrant Charged With Laundering Proceeds From $1.3 Billion Healthcare Fraud

Federal prosecutors have charged a 33-year-old illegal alien from the country of Georgia with conspiracy to launder money from a health fraud scheme that billed more than $1.3 billion.

The Justice Department says Erekle Gugava opened bank accounts as the owner of a Pennsylvania medical equipment firm called ND Medical Solutions LLC from February to July of 2025.

Prosecutors say the company sent at least $1.3 billion in false claims for medical equipment using stolen identities. Insurers paid about $6.5 million.

According to the DOJ, Gugava deposited the checks and moved the money overseas to a criminal group based in Russia.

A grand jury in Massachusetts returned the indictment.

The case is part of Operation Gold Rush, which the department calls the largest health care fraud case it has ever brought.

Says Assistant Attorney General Colin M. McDonald,

“Fraud networks cannot function without people willing to launder and transmit their proceeds — and deterring those facilitators is essential to safeguarding taxpayer resources.”
